Furnished Houses Booking Website
LuxuryStay is a polished hospitality-focused website template for businesses offering luxury furnished apartments, serviced stays, premium villas, penthouses, and executive short-term rentals. It includes an elegant public website, property listings with filters and map view, detailed property pages with booking requests, client dashboard, admin dashboard, booking and payment tracking, messaging, notifications, editable site settings, and demo fallback data for reliable showcasing even before backend setup is completed.
